Ingredients for Peanut Butter and Marshmallow Fluff Salad
- 1 cup peanut butter
- 1 cup marshmallow fluff
- 2 cups mini marshmallows
- 1 cup chopped apples
- 1 cup chopped celery
- 1/2 cup raisins
- 1/2 cup chopped nuts (optional)
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
The key ingredients in this salad create a delightful interplay of flavors. Opt for creamy peanut butter for a smoother texture, or choose crunchy for added pizazz. Marshmallow fluff thickens the base with its sugary sweetness. Fresh apples add a crisp bite, and celery introduces an unexpected crunch that beautifully offsets the creaminess.
For a twist, substitute apples with pears or add diced strawberries for a burst of color. Feel free to play with different nuts—a handful of walnuts or almonds can add a satisfying crunch that elevates the dish.
How to Make Peanut Butter and Marshmallow Fluff Salad
- Combine the Base: In a large bowl, mix together the peanut butter and marshmallow fluff until well incorporated. Stir vigorously to achieve a homogenous blend that’s creamy and inviting.
- Fold in the Crunch: Gently fold in the mini marshmallows, chopped apples, celery, raisins, and nuts if you’re adding them. Be careful not to over-mix; you want to keep the marshmallows intact for delightful pops of sweetness.
- Add Lemon Zing: Drizzle the lemon juice over your creation. This not only adds a burst of freshness but also helps prevent the apples from browning. Stir gently to combine all ingredients without compromising their textures.
- Serve or Chill: You can serve immediately for a fresh experience, or chill it in the refrigerator for an hour to allow the flavors to meld beautifully. Enjoy it on a hot day or as a sweet complement to a meal!
Chef’s Notes & Helpful Tips
- Make-Ahead Tips: This salad keeps well in the fridge. Prepare it a day in advance for flavors that deepen and become even more delightful.
- Customization Ideas: Experiment with different fruits like bananas or berries. You can also try adding a hint of vanilla for extra depth.
- Healthy Alternatives: Swap regular peanut butter for a natural or reduced-fat version for a lighter option without sacrificing flavor.
- Serving Suggestions: Make individual cups for a fun presentation at parties, or serve it family-style in a large bowl.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Overmixing: You want to maintain texture, so fold ingredients gently to avoid squishing the marshmallows.
- Using Brown Apples: Prevent browning by adding lemon juice as recommended. It spices up the flavor while keeping your salad looking fresh and inviting.
- Skipping the Chill: Letting the salad chill allows the flavors to come together for a more harmonious taste experience.

Storage & Reheating Instructions
This salad tastes best chilled and remains good in the refrigerator for about 3-5 days. Store it in an airtight container to maintain freshness. Avoid freezing, as the texture of the ingredients may become unappealing when thawed. If you need to serve it later, a quick stir before serving will bring it back to its creamy glory.

FAQs
Can I make this salad vegan?
Absolutely! Use a plant-based peanut butter and a vegan marshmallow fluff alternative. You’ll still enjoy that creamy sweetness without any animal products.
What happens if I leave out the nuts?
Leaving out the nuts will result in a slightly softer texture, but you’ll still have a delicious, creamy salad. You could substitute with toasted seeds for crunch if desired.
Can I add yogurt to this salad?
Certainly! Incorporating yogurt can provide a tangy twist and make the salad even creamier. Just adjust the sweetness to taste.
How can I make this salad healthier?
Consider reducing the peanut butter and marshmallow fluff quantity or replacing some with Greek yogurt. Add more fruits and vegetables to enhance the nutritional profile.
Is this salad safe for children?
Yes! This salad is a kid-friendly treat, but be mindful of potential nut allergies when serving. You can easily substitute with sunflower seed butter for a safe, delicious alternative.
